Is Mercedes c300 front wheel drive?

The most common layout for a rear-wheel-drive car is a with the engine and transmission at the front of the car, mounted longitudinally. The 2019 Mercedes Benz C-Class C300 boasts a 255 horsepower, turbocharged 2.0-liter four-cylinder engine, paired with a nine-speed automatic transmission, and rear-wheel drive.

Why is front wheel drive bad?

Front-wheel drive has worse acceleration than rear-wheel drive, which is why most sporty and race cars use rear-wheel drive. With all the weight up front, front-wheel drive can make handling more difficult. CV joints/boots in FWD vehicles tend to wear out sooner than rear-wheel drive vehicles.

Are RWD cars dangerous?

They are only relatively unsafe when compared to 4WD or AWD cars and that's because these two can distribute the power generated across all 4 wheels. RWD cars can oversteer: lose grip at the rear when the car crosses it's limit and an average road driver will find it difficult to control the resulting slide.

How can you tell if a car is front or rear wheel drive?

If the engine is transverse-mounted (that is, mounted sideways), with the belts facing one side of the car, your car is most likely a front-wheel drive car. If the engine is mounted longitudinally (front to back), with the belts facing the front grille, your car is most likely a rear-wheel drive car.

Is a Mercedes Benz front wheel drive?

Mercedes-Benz To Offer Front-Wheel Drive Models in U.S. Mercedes-Benz has two front-wheel-drive models now, the A-Class (shown) and B-Class, both of which are popular in Europe. However, it has not yet offered either car in the U.S. market, fearing that two compact hatchbacks could dilute its luxury-car brand.

What is the difference between Mercedes c200 and c300?

The difference between the two is under the bonnet, with the C300 powered by a 190kW/370Nm 2.0-litre turbocharged petrol engine that has considerably more punch than the C200's 1.5-litre petrol with 'EQ' mild-hybrid technology that produces 135kW/280Nm.

Where is the Mercedes c300 built?

Mercedes-Benz U.S. International (MBUSI) is a Mercedes-Benz automobile manufacturing plant near Vance, Alabama. It is located about 34 miles (55 km) west of Birmingham and about 19 miles (31 km) east of downtown Tuscaloosa. The factory was announced in 1993 and produced its first vehicle, an ML320, in February 1997.

What kind of gas does a Mercedes c300 take?

All Mercedes-Benz gasoline cars require Premium Unleaded Gas. At a minimum, you should use premium 91 octane gasoline or higher. Avoid using low octane gas such as: Regular Unleaded Octane 87.
